Output e860cb876e58dcb84ae56b5ff76393d2597329388aa308fa0dda327f3dbbb602:0

value
374912967166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b93eab08cba63955a90e2b75a52712ba3e525e09 OP_EQUAL
address
3JaW1HgoUELUxrhNmGLU9n2xrYwnHepHAY
transaction
e860cb876e58dcb84ae56b5ff76393d2597329388aa308fa0dda327f3dbbb602
confirmations
178204
spent
true